Pressure Washing Wood Surfaces



When pressure washing timber surface areas, it's essential to choose the ideal devices and strategy to prevent damage. Start by choosing a stress washer with flexible settings. A lower stress, generally in between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is excellent for wood. This assists avoid gouging or stripping the timber fibers.

Prior to you begin, see to it to get rid of the area of furnishings, plants, and various other obstacles. It's necessary to test a tiny, low-profile area first to ensure your method and stress setups will not damage the surface area.

Make use of a follower nozzle attachment for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at the very least 12 inches away from the timber to decrease the threat of damage.

As you wash, move in long, sweeping movements along the grain of the timber. This technique helps raise dust and particles properly without leaving streaks.

After cleaning, rinse the surface area completely to remove any kind of remaining cleaning option. Permit the wood to completely dry completely prior to using any sealant or tarnish. Complying with these actions will ensure your wood surface areas continue to be in excellent condition while looking fresh and tidy.

Strategies for Cleaning Concrete



Concrete surfaces can collect dirt, grime, and discolorations over time, making reliable cleaning methods crucial. To begin, you'll want to use a stress wash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This level of stress efficiently eliminates persistent spots without damaging the surface.

Prior to you start,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of detergent and water. Permit it to dwell for regarding 10-15 minutes; this aids break down challenging stains.

Next off, attach a wide spray nozzle to your stress washing machine, ideally a 25-degree or 40-degree idea. This will disperse the water equally and minimize the threat of etching.



When you begin pressure cleaning, operate in sections. Maintain the nozzle regarding 12 inches from the surface and maintain a constant, sweeping activity. This strategy ensures you don't miss any kind of spots or use excessive pressure in one location.

Finally, rinse the location thoroughly after cleansing. This action protects against any type of deposit from staying on the concrete, leaving it clean and looking fresh.

Best Practices for Vinyl Siding



Vinyl home siding is a preferred choice for homeowners as a result of its resilience and low maintenance needs. Nevertheless, to maintain it looking its best, you'll require to push wash it occasionally.

Begin by preparing the area-- remove any furnishings, plants, or obstacles near your home. Next off, pick a stress washing machine with a nozzle that delivers a wide spray; usually, a 25-degree nozzle works well.

Prior to you start, examine a tiny area to ensure your setups won't damage the siding. Keep the pressure below 2000 PSI to stay clear of any damages or splits. Start from the bottom and function your means up, cleaning in areas to stop streaks.

Use a detergent specifically developed for vinyl house siding to aid get rid of dust and mold and mildew. Use it with your stress washer or a pump sprayer, allowing it to sit for about 10 mins.

Later, wash thoroughly from the top down, guaranteeing all detergent is removed. Lastly, check the house siding for any missed spots or persistent discolorations that might need additional attention.

Routine upkeep will certainly keep your plastic house siding looking fresh and extend its life-span, making it a beneficial financial investment for your home.
